Configuration and Setup:
Manifold type: 96-/384-well washing: Dual-Action 96-tube (8x12)
Microplate Types: 96, 384; Plate Profile: standard
Volume range: 25 – 3,000 uL/well
Shaking: YES, Soaking: YES
Number Dispensing Liquids: 1 (up to 4 with Valve Module - not included)
Wash speed: 96-well, 3 cycles, 300 uL/well: <30 seconds; 384-well, 3 cycles, 100 uL/well: <80 seconds
Options: Dual Manifold, Buffer Switching, Programmable Shaking
Dimensions (D x W x H): 17 x 14 x 10 in (43.2 x 35.6 x 25.4 cm)
Weight: 30 lbs (13.5 kg)
Power: 100 - 240 VAC. 50/60 Hz

The BioTek 405 Select TS Microplate Washer provides microplate priming, washing, and dispensing for ELISA, fluorescence and chemiluminescence immunoassays, cellular and agglutination assays.

Every instrument has unique packing and shipping needs. Few instruments can be safely shipped via Pacel, and most require the safety of a well-built crate.

Here we are showing you our standard packing process  

      1. All items are different, but they all follow the same principle when packaging.

      2. Start with a well-constructed crate

A well-constructed crate would consist of 1/2” to 5/8” Plywood with framing. We generally purchase our crates from a third party who specializes in custom crates.

      3. You always want the Instrument to not be directly on the wood deck of the crate. This is done by placing it on foam, inside of the crate. We use 2” 1.7 lb. density foam which works great. It provides cushioning and enough firmness to support the Instrument.

      4. The next step is to make sure there is nothing on the deck of the Instrument and the Head/ Arm is secured. In some cases there will be multiple arms to secure but for this example there is only one. The reason for this is so there is no free movement during transit which could cause serious damage to the Instrument.

      5. The next step is to make sure your Instrument is covered in either a pallet bag or shrink wrap so no dust or foreign object will get into the crate.

      6. The next step is to secure the instrument inside the crate by bracing. We use a method of 2x4’s which have 1” foam shrink wrapped to them so no piece of wood touches the actual instrument.

      7. Final step is to photograph everything inside the crate and then seal it with screws.
